Transaction 520864fc49477e0652a22e55e68d03a96b2fdc80ba5d86b38981a3cd4a303337
1 Input
1 Output
-
520864fc49477e0652a22e55e68d03a96b2fdc80ba5d86b38981a3cd4a303337:0
- value
- 111051
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22e423945ea69e90664e652685b0fb20b8f7901a OP_EQUAL
- address
- 34sWCSVkkRaPprUD6YFjZaAoqVhpA4ekyd